The Director, Client Engagement plays a vital leadership role in ensuring client happiness, enhancing business impact, and coordinating account profitability. You’ll lead a team that orchestrates work across various internal teams to deliver a consistent and positive client experience. How You’ll Make an Impact
This role reports to a senior leader within the Client Engagement organization. You will engage in close collaboration with internal sales, client services, and delivery teams, in addition to external client participants. You’ll lead all aspects of a matrixed, cross‑functional team, delivering timely performance evaluations to both direct and indirect reports. You excel in taking ownership and solving intricate challenges. You’ll play a direct role in crafting client happiness and profitability, collaborating with a large, geographically dispersed, and multicultural organization. You will partner with clients to define and implement their vision, driving significant business outcomes. The role offers a unique balance of leadership, strategy, and hands‑on problem‑solving. You will lead efforts to streamline engagement delivery, focusing on improving value for clients. You’ll act as a trusted advisor, negotiating with key partners to achieve desired business outcomes and eliminate roadblocks. You will also be a key leader in orchestrating solutions across multiple products to meet complex client needs. What You’ll Achieve
